Every great game deserves a sequel, right? Well in 2009 FEAR got a sequel, released for PC, Xbox 360, and PS3.In FEAR 2 you play as Sgt. Michael Becket, a member of the Delta Force squad of F.E.A.R as they embark on a mission to at first, apprehend Genevieve Aristide(a character whose name was mentioned prominently in the first game), but after that mission goes sour, (due to this happening roughly approximately the same time as final part of the first game), Becket and the rest of Delta Force seek out to defeat Alma Wade, that creepy girl who would crop up every now and then in the first game.(I'm probably going to be saying "In the first game." a lot.
In the first FEAR, which had a lot of flamboyant smoke, and particle effects, which I'll admit looked pretty cool at first, but once I got over it, I found that these effects were obnoxious and were a terrible impediment, making it a bit difficult to sometimes keep track of enemies, here they're not quite as bad or prominent as they were back then.
I konw this may seem like a minor thing, but I do like that they didn't go the regenerating health route,as many games around that time(Hell, even to this day.) were starting to implement regenerating health.
But much like the first game, FEAR 2 does still does have a tendency to lend itself into repetition, the enemies now kinda come after you in waves, which can get a little irritating, plus some annoying enemy type that crop up every now and then, but "The Reflex time slow-mo ability" does make them a bit more tolerable to deal with.
If you were a big fan of the first FEAR, then I have no problem recommending FEAR 2, it may be just be more of the same, but then again, if you have no problem with that, who am I to complain?
